]> git.ipfire.org Git - thirdparty/systemd.git/commit - src/libsystemd/sd-event/sd-event.c
sd-event: do not arm timers unnecessarily
authorTom Gundersen <teg@jklm.no>
Wed, 13 Aug 2014 22:22:27 +0000 (00:22 +0200)
committerTom Gundersen <teg@jklm.no>
Wed, 13 Aug 2014 23:29:51 +0000 (01:29 +0200)
commit212bbb1798e5746a669dfba4a1732a4eabe4f2d8
tree59ca18cec9b0de6c522e0e426d9b69a28156f676
parente92da1e5d0a3b38804e173af136ec7a076c7757e
sd-event: do not arm timers unnecessarily

Rather than recalculating the next timeout on every loop, we only do it when something changed.
src/libsystemd/sd-event/sd-event.c